結論:AIがあれば中学生でもブログは作れる
このブログ「invest-at-13」は、プログラミング知識ゼロの14歳が作った。
使ったのはAI。コードを書いたのもAI。デザインを整えたのもAI。SEO対策もセキュリティ強化も、全部AIに指示を出してやってもらった。
かかった費用は0円。
この記事では、実際にどうやってブログを立ち上げて、どう運営しているかを全部書く。「自分もやってみたい」って思ってる中学生・高校生に向けて。
使ってる技術スタック
| 項目 | ツール | 費用 |
|---|---|---|
| フレームワーク | Astro | 無料 |
| ホスティング | Cloudflare Pages | 無料 |
| AI(コード生成) | Claude Code | 無料枠 |
| AI(記事作成補助) | Claude / ChatGPT | 無料 |
| バージョン管理 | GitHub | 無料 |
| 画像作成 | Gemini / Python | 無料 |
| SEO確認 | Google Search Console | 無料 |
合計:0円。
ちなみにAstroは2026年にCloudflareの傘下に入った。つまりAstro + Cloudflareの組み合わせは今後さらに相性が良くなる。
ブログ構築編:ゼロからサイトを作るまで
ステップ1:Astroプロジェクトを作る
ターミナルで npm create astro@latest を実行する。これだけでブログのテンプレートが作れる。
……と書いたけど、正直に言うと僕はこのコマンドの意味もわかってなかった。 全部Claude Code(AIのコーディングツール)に「ブログを作って」って指示を出して、AIがコマンドを実行してくれた。
ステップ2:GitHub にコードを上げる
GitHubはコードを保存する場所。AIに「GitHubにプッシュして」って言えばやってくれる。
最初は「プッシュって何?」状態だったけど、AIの指示に従ってるうちに覚えた。
ステップ3:Cloudflare Pages でデプロイ
Cloudflare Pagesの管理画面でGitHubのリポジトリを接続する。これでGitHubにコードを上げるたびに、自動でブログが更新される。
ここまでの作業時間は約3時間。プログラミングの知識は一切使ってない。
→ 詳しい手順は プログラミング知識ゼロの14歳が、AIと一緒にブログを1から作った話 に書いてある。
記事作成編:AIとの共同作業
記事の書き方
- テーマを決める(自分で考える)
- 構成をAIに相談する(「この内容で見出しを考えて」)
- 下書きを自分で書く
- AIにチェックしてもらう(誤字、わかりにくい部分、事実確認)
- 自分で最終調整して公開
大事なのはAIに丸投げしないこと。 テーマ選びと最終判断は自分でやる。AIは「超優秀なアシスタント」であって、「代わりに書いてくれるマシン」じゃない。
AIツールの使い分け
| 作業 | 使うAI | 理由 |
|---|---|---|
| 記事の構成 | Claude | 論理的な構成が得意 |
| 事実確認 | Perplexity | 出典付きで答えてくれる |
| コード修正 | Claude Code | ターミナル操作まで全部やってくれる |
| 画像作成 | Gemini / Python | 無料で画像生成できる |
| 翻訳チェック | DeepL | 英語の情報を調べるとき |
→ 各AIツールの詳細は 中学生が無料で使えるAIツール全まとめ【2026年4月版】 にまとめてある。
SEO対策編:Googleに見つけてもらう
ブログを作っただけじゃ、誰にも読んでもらえない。Google検索に表示されないと、存在しないのと同じ。
やったこと
- Google Search Console にサイトを登録
- サイトマップを送信(Astroが自動で生成してくれる)
- 各記事のURLをインデックス登録リクエスト
- 内部リンクを整備(記事同士をつなげる)
- メタディスクリプションを全記事に設定
- タグを整理
結果
- サイトマップ送信から約10日でインデックス開始
- 現時点でGoogle検索に表示され始めた
- 検索クリックも発生し始めた
SEO対策も全部AIに「やって」って指示しただけ。AIがrobots.txt、JSON-LD構造化データ、OGP設定まで全部やってくれた。
→ SEOの詳しい話は SEOって何?14歳が自分のブログで実際にやってみた で書いてる。
セキュリティ編:攻撃されても大丈夫にする
ブログを公開するってことは、世界中からアクセスされるってこと。悪意のある攻撃を受ける可能性もある。
やったセキュリティ対策
| 対策 | 内容 |
|---|---|
| CORS制限 | APIのアクセスを自分のドメインだけに制限 |
| セキュリティヘッダー | X-Frame-Options、CSPなど6種類を設定 |
| 個人情報の削除 | ブログ内の年齢・学年の具体的な記載を削除 |
| GitHubトークンの定期ローテーション | 古いトークンを削除して新しく発行 |
これも全部AIに「セキュリティ強化して」って指示したら、何をすべきか提案してくれて、実装までやってくれた。
費用まとめ:本当に0円
| 項目 | 月額費用 |
|---|---|
| Astro(フレームワーク) | 0円 |
| Cloudflare Pages(ホスティング) | 0円 |
| GitHub(コード管理) | 0円 |
| Google Search Console(SEO) | 0円 |
| Claude(AI) | 0円(無料枠) |
| ChatGPT(AI) | 0円(無料枠) |
| ドメイン | 0円(pages.devを使用) |
| 合計 | 0円 |
WordPressだとレンタルサーバー代(月1,000円前後)とドメイン代(年1,500円前後)がかかる。Astro + Cloudflareなら完全無料。
現在の運営状況(2026年4月時点)
- 記事数: 19本
- カテゴリ: AI活用 / 投資 / ゲーム / 料理 / ガジェット
- Google検索: インデックス開始済み
- 月間アクセス: まだ少ない(始めたばかり)
- 収益: まだ0円(これから)
正直に言うと、まだ収益は出ていない。でもブログを作って12日で、Googleの検索に載り始めた。 ゼロからのスタートとしては悪くないと思ってる。
AIでブログ運営して学んだこと
① AIは「何でもやってくれる魔法」じゃない
AIに「面白い記事を書いて」って丸投げしても、面白い記事は出てこない。テーマを考えるのは自分、最終チェックも自分。 AIは道具であって、脳の代わりじゃない。
② 事実確認は絶対に自分でやる
AIは平気で嘘をつく。特に数字やランキングは要注意。このブログでもRobloxの人気ゲームランキングでAIが3回間違ったデータを出してきて、全部書き直した。
③ 「知らない」はハンデじゃない
プログラミングを知らなくても、SEOを知らなくても、セキュリティを知らなくても、AIに聞けば教えてくれるし、やってくれる。 「知らない」は始めない理由にならない。
④ 継続が一番難しい
ブログ構築は1日でできた。でも、毎日記事を書き続けるのは大変。技術より「続けること」の方がずっと難しい。
これからやること
- 記事を30本まで増やす(Google AdSense申請の目安)
- X(Twitter)で発信を始める
- noteで有料コンテンツを出す
- 月間1万PVを目指す
目標はブログで月10万円の収益を出すこと。14歳でも、AIがあれば不可能じゃないと思ってる。
同じことをやりたい人へ
必要なものはこれだけ:
- パソコン(MacでもWindowsでも)
- AIアカウント(Claude、ChatGPT、どれか1つでOK)
- やる気
プログラミングの知識はいらない。お金もいらない。年齢も関係ない。
「自分もブログを作ってみたい」と思ったら、まずAIに「Astroでブログを作りたい」って聞いてみて。そこから全部始まる。
関連記事
→ プログラミング知識ゼロの14歳が、AIと一緒にブログを1から作った話
→ 中学生が無料で使えるAIツール全まとめ【2026年4月版】